From 736bd34d8c496b81d456d4e4897197eac344247d Mon Sep 17 00:00:00 2001 From: Zog Date: Wed, 14 Feb 2018 15:13:21 +0100 Subject: Refs #5924 @2h; Update specs --- app/models/chouette/line.rb | 3 +++ 1 file changed, 3 insertions(+) (limited to 'app/models/chouette/line.rb') diff --git a/app/models/chouette/line.rb b/app/models/chouette/line.rb index ba2e2755d..874353752 100644 --- a/app/models/chouette/line.rb +++ b/app/models/chouette/line.rb @@ -41,6 +41,7 @@ module Chouette validates_presence_of :name + scope :by_text, ->(text) { where('lower(name) LIKE :t or lower(published_name) LIKE :t or lower(objectid) LIKE :t or lower(comment) LIKE :t or lower(number) LIKE :t', t: "%#{text.downcase}%") } @@ -48,6 +49,8 @@ module Chouette [:published_name, :number, :comment, :url, :color, :text_color, :stable_id] end + def local_id; registration_number end + def geometry_presenter Chouette::Geometry::LinePresenter.new self end -- cgit v1.2.3